3、toRef和context 使用toRef 解构的属性可能不存在,使用toRef给一个默认值,就能够在以后改变的时候实现响应式; 但并不建议这么做,无数据的时候可以给空,或者默认值; 代码语言:javascript 代码运行次数:0 复制Cloud Studio 代码运行 <!DOCTYPE html> hello vue <!-- 引入Vue库 --> <...
vue3 toRef 以及 context 参数,toRef的使用:Context使用:context里面有3个参数,{attrs,slots,emit}:1.attrs的使用:其实就是父组件传递的属性constapp=Vue.createApp({//使用组件childtemplate:`<c
Context 使用: context 里面有3个参数, {attrs,slots,emit} : 1.attrs 的使用: 其实就是父组件传递的属性 View Code 2.slots 其实就是父组件的插槽 View Code 注意:如果你不用这个setup 你完全可以这样获取: 这也是以前的获取方法,一样的。。。 3. emit ,其实就是事件: View Code...
npm install -save @imengyu/vue3-context-menu 然后在 main.ts 中导入: import'@imengyu/vue3-context-menu/lib/vue3-context-menu.css'importContextMenufrom'@imengyu/vue3-context-menu'createApp(App).use(ContextMenu) 然后你就可以在 vue 文件中使用菜单了: importContextMenufrom'@imengyu/vue3-conte...
一、父组件 <template> 我是父组件 counter:{{ counter }} 调用子组件方法 <children :message="message" @changeCounter="changeCounter" ref="childrenRef" ></children> </template> import { ref } from "vue"; import children from "./children...
在Vue 3项目中集成vue-contextmenujs插件,可以按照以下步骤进行。vue-contextmenujs是一个用于创建右键上下文菜单的Vue插件。以下是详细的步骤和代码示例: 1. 安装vue-contextmenujs 首先,你需要在你的Vue 3项目中安装vue-contextmenujs。你可以使用npm或yarn进行安装: bash npm install vue-contextmenujs --save ...
Vue3 中 Context的用法Context 传递给 setup 函数的第二个参数是 context。context 是一个普通的 JavaScript 对象,它暴露组件的三个 property: export default { setup(props, context) { // Attribute (非响应…
1npm install v-contextmenu-vue3 # 假设存在的Vue 3兼容 库名 2# 或者 3yarn add v-contextmenu-vue3 2.全局注册在你的项目的入口文件(如main.js)中全局注册该组件:Javascript 1import { createApp } from'vue';2import VContextMenu from'v-contextmenu-vue3'; // 替换为实际的Vue3组件库 3...
【Vue3 从入门到实战 进阶式掌握完整知识体系】032-Composition API:toRef和context,文章目录3、toRef和context使用toRef运行结果context中的attrs和slots运行结果context中的e
vue3引入了组合式 API,主要是基于Vue 3中数据可变的、细粒度的响应性系统为基础,利用函数不同组合方式来编程。提供了更好的逻辑复用、更灵活的代码组织、更好的类型推导等 具体在应用中的区别如下: 一、创建实例的方式: Vue 2:使用new Vue()来创建Vue实例,代码如下: ...